Ivory Coast, also known as Côte d'Ivoire, stretches approximately 500 miles (about 800 kilometers) from its northern border with Burkina Faso to its southern coastline along the Gulf of Guinea. The country has a diverse geography, ranging from coastal regions to mountainous areas in the west. Its length can vary depending on the specific measurement points used.
